对素数取模一般能得到较好的离散效果,如果你对10006或10008取模,那所有2的倍数仍然都是2的倍数,对于某些数据(全奇全偶神马的)离散效果不好,取其他数的倍数也会遇到类似的问题,所以习惯上对素数取模,至于离10000最近只是根据数据规模的大小取数的时候,大家都喜欢离整数近长得好看的……结果一 题目 ACM题目里...为什么...
10000以后素数表 10001-20000一共有1033个质数 1000710009100371003910061100671006910079100911009310099101031011110133101391014110151101591016310169101771018110193102111022310243102471025310259102671027110273102891030110303103131032110331103331033710343103571036910391103991042710429104331045310457
c语言编程,求比10000大且是最小的素数。#include<stdio.h>int isPrime(int n){int i;for (i=2; i<=n/2; i++)if (n %i == 0)return 0;return 1;}int main(){int n = 10000;while (0 == isPrime(n)){n++
1、Input #1, c 应该在循环体内 2、For j = 2 To Sqr(i) 应改为:For j = 2 To Sqr(C) C是需要判断其是否为素数
有问题找客服
return 1;//执行到这里说明为奇素数 } int main() { int n;printf("Input a number: ");scanf("%d", &n);//三重循环来遍历所有组合 for (int i = 3; i < n; ++i) {//第一个数取值3~n-1 for (int j = 3; j < n; ++j) { for (int k = 3; k < n; ++k) { ...